Character Name: Arcrane

• Race/Class:
Tauren/Druid

• Armory Link:
http://eu.wowarmory.com/character-sheet.xml?r=Earthen+Ring&cn=Arcrane

• What is the hardest or craziest achievement you have done in the game?
Hardest: Level 80, man that was a ball-ache ;P
Craziest: Leeeeeeeeeeeeeroy, always a fun one


• What raid experience do you have? (Any raid experience counts. Elaborate, please.)
I leveled in Vanilla, quit for a long time then came back towards the end of tbc so not much raiding in that wow generation, Karazhan was my first raid to complete, went with friends and pugs
Ulduar was the first raid I did as a guild run, using vent, finalising every little detail before a boss, all that exciting shiz


• Why do you have your current spec?
BOOM!kin baby. High DPS single target, even higher aoe ;P what could be better?

• What do you believe your class (and spec) brings to raids?
GotW, sick buff, plus iv got it improved *flex
Moonkin aura+ IMF, spell crit increased by 5% and haste increased by 3%
Typhoon, never know when pushing a whole load of angry mobs from the raid can be useful


Also, on a profession basis, I am top level in lw and skinning and have many ICC recipes that will useful for the guild

• If you could only keep one of your current talents, which one would it be and why?
Starfall, the most OP ability since the new patch, just as useful now on single target than lots of mobs

• Do you have an offspec that you're able to play well?
My OS is pvp resto, the tree is very pvp based so wont be able to use for raids, plus my lack of pve healing gear anyway

• Name one personal PvE weakness, and be honest:
Depending on my internet as it seems to change every day, lag. Use to be a major problem but got it fixed up to a playable standard.
Also cr dead bodies during a fight, I can never find where my peers die -.-


• Our raid days are Tuesday, Wednesday and Sunday from 1900 to 2300, how many of those days can you attend on an average basis?
Tuesday and Sunday, probably Wednesday depending on work

• What is expertise good for?
nothing (for me)
But it reduces the chance the target will dodge or parry a melee attack


• What do you expect to gain from being a part of Murder?
A raiding experience for a hardcore raid group, also trust and friendship with the members

• If you could go back in time to give yourself one tip about your class what would it be?
Level in feral, a lot less deaths, a lot more fun

• Do you know someone that's currently in the guild?
nope, but I'm hoping that will change Smile

• Tell us a bit about yourself. (For instance name, age, profession, nationality, hobbies and your favorite animal)
My name is Seb, just turned 18, I am from Leicestershire in England. Yes, we are crap at football and didn't make it to the final *waves fist at Dutch
I draw, watch movies with mates and play Table Tennis, yes, I am THAT cool


• Why do you raid?
Enjoyment; the communication, the laughs and trying to be the best at what I do (dps)
